What is the average MOT pass rate for a Vauxhall Mokka X Griffin Turbo Auto?

The Vauxhall Mokka X Griffin Turbo Auto has an average 97.7% MOT pass rate across model years 2019 to 2019, based on DVSA test data.

What are the most common MOT failures on a Vauxhall Mokka X Griffin Turbo Auto?

The most common MOT failure reasons for the Vauxhall Mokka X Griffin Turbo Auto across all years are: wiper blade missing or obviously not clearing the windscreen, a lamp missing, inoperative or in the case of a multiple light source more than 1/2 not functioning, a brake lining or pad worn below 1.5mm. These are typical wear items that can often be checked and addressed before your test.
